WebEuler Paths and Circuits. A graph has an Euler circuit if and only if the degree of every vertex is even. A graph has an Euler path if and only if there are at most two vertices with odd degree. Since the bridges of Königsberg graph has all four vertices with odd degree, there is no Euler path through the graph. (a) If a graph has other than two vertices of odd degree, then it cannot have an Euler path. (b) If a graph is connected and has exactly two vertices of odd degree, then it has at least one Euler path. Every Euler path has to start at one of the vertices of odd degree and end at the other.
